Top Tips for Lowering Your Life Insurance Premiums

Looking for ways to cut down on life insurance costs can really help with your financial planning. One smart move is to get quotes from different companies. Each one might charge different rates for the same coverage. I found that using online tools or talking to agents makes finding the best deal easier.

Shop Around for Quotes

When I started comparing life insurance quotes, I was amazed at the price differences. Some companies had much lower rates than others for the same policy. It’s key to know that monthly premiums can vary a lot between providers.

By doing my homework and getting several quotes, I found a policy that fit my budget and needs better.

Choose the Right Type of Policy

Choosing the right policy type is also key to saving money. For those with dependents, term life insurance is often a good choice. It’s usually cheaper and meets short-term needs well.

Whole life insurance, with its cash value, might seem appealing. But it usually costs more. Knowing these differences helped me pick the best policy for me and possibly lower my costs.

Choosing the Appropriate Coverage Amount

Finding the right life insurance coverage is key to protecting my family’s financial future. It’s important to understand my financial needs to avoid over-insuring or under-insuring. This careful planning can save money and ensure my loved ones are well-protected.

Calculating Your Financial Needs

I start by listing all my financial responsibilities. This includes debts, daily expenses, and future costs like my kids’ education. A life insurance calculator is very helpful in figuring out these needs. It helps me consider things like:

  • Funeral costs
  • End-of-life care
  • Estate planning expenses
  • Mortgage payments
  • College tuition for dependents

I usually multiply my annual income by 10 to 15 times. This gives me a good starting point for figuring out how much coverage I need.

Avoiding Over-Insurance

Many worry about over-insuring, which can raise premiums too high. Remember, over-insuring doesn’t mean better protection. It can actually cost more without adding to my financial safety. Knowing what I really need helps me avoid this problem.

I always read the policy details carefully. Term life is cheaper for short-term needs, while permanent policies are more expensive but last a lifetime. It’s important to find the right balance in coverage amounts. I look at options from $100,000 to over $1,000,000, depending on my financial situation.

Health Considerations for Lower Premiums

Knowing how health affects life insurance costs is key. Insurers often ask for a medical exam to check your health. This helps them figure out if you might face health risks that could raise your premium. Getting a good result from the exam can help lower your rates, so it’s important to do well.

The Importance of a Medical Exam

The medical exam is a big part of figuring out your life insurance costs. Insurers look at things like nicotine use, weight, and health issues like high cholesterol. Chronic illnesses can make insurance more expensive, so staying healthy is a big plus.

Policies without exams might cost a lot more. This shows how important it is to show you’re healthy to meet the insurance company’s criteria.

Maintaining a Healthy Lifestyle

To keep costs down, staying healthy is essential. Regular exercise, balanced eating, avoiding tobacco, and managing stress are all good. These habits not only improve your health but can also lower your insurance costs.

Insurance companies like to see healthy habits. They might even give you discounts for it. By making healthy choices, you can avoid extra costs due to health risks.

Bundling Insurance Policies for Discounts

I’ve also started bundling insurance policies. This means combining life insurance with auto or home insurance to get discounts. Many companies offer these deals, helping me save money and simplify my payments. It makes managing my finances easier, so I can keep my coverage up to date.
